Output 142b58eb6e3e906f14156e3eb41c78e9beaa8c908e4268aee3ffbdac574881cb:2

value
39369660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ccd4420bb39ae19362329d3d2297b8ed1ce3c9 OP_EQUAL
address
MPHh8SCkSXs9cQa8avwzWxidqSRC5bYyQc
transaction
142b58eb6e3e906f14156e3eb41c78e9beaa8c908e4268aee3ffbdac574881cb
spent
true